Design Systems Maturity: A Key to Scalable Growth
As companies grow and expand, their design systems must evolve to keep pace. An Advanced Certificate in Design Systems focuses on design systems maturity, which refers to the ability of an organization to consistently deliver high-quality, user-centered design solutions at scale. By achieving design systems maturity, businesses can reduce design debt, improve collaboration between teams, and increase the overall efficiency of their design processes. This, in turn, enables them to respond more quickly to changing market conditions and drive scalable product growth. For instance, companies like Airbnb and Uber have successfully implemented design systems to streamline their design processes, resulting in improved user experiences and increased customer engagement.

Future-Proofing Design Systems: Trends and Innovations
As design systems continue to evolve, it's essential for professionals to stay ahead of the curve and anticipate future trends and innovations. An Advanced Certificate in Design Systems provides a forward-looking perspective on the field, exploring emerging trends such as design tokens, federated design systems, and the role of design systems in driving business strategy. By understanding these trends and innovations, professionals can future-proof their design systems, ensuring they remain adaptable, resilient, and poised for scalable product growth. For instance, companies like Google and Microsoft are already experimenting with design tokens, which enable them to create consistent design languages across multiple products and platforms.
